Logistics Dispatcher
Basic Duties and Responsibilities
- Print orders and Bills of Lading.
- Obtain and distribute diagrams on ships.
- Obtain surveyor questionnaire for testing requirements.
- Ensure all required information and documentation has been received for all movement types prior to scheduling (i.e., ethanol, imports, exports, vapor recovery, barge certification of inspections, etc.).
- Obtain and enter ETAs from barge companies and ship agents.
- Calculate shore stops.
- Schedule marine movements per dock, product availability and customer's specifications including the notification of third-party inspectors as nominated by the customer.
- Coordinate and schedule pipeline and tank-to-tank transfer movements.
- Work closely with the Security department and the US Coast Guard to ensure safe marine loading and offloading.
- Interact with customers as needed to ensure product movements are scheduled accurately and timely.
- Assemble and distribute order packages, DOI/NCR/MSDS/Vapor Recovery (if needed).
- Work closely with Marine Coordinators to ensure proper product levels for scheduled moves.
- Coordinate all direct moves with Truck and Rail, as needed.
- Special duties as per the customer's requirements as requested.
- Enters all pertinent times for marine movements in JDE dock scheduler to close out the order and distributes completed paperwork.
- After Hours/Weekends/Holidays and as needed by Marine Coordinators and Lead Marine Scheduler:
- Enter customer orders into JD Edwards system including Special Service Requests (SSR) as needed.
- Coordinate monthly marine blanket bulk orders.
- Report to the customer any relevant information relating to delays or issues with their marine moves.
- Process all trucks to load or unload at the terminal including:
- Check truck driver credentials, i.e. driver's license, TWIC card, etc. Also, check for compliance to ITC safety rules, i.e. facial hair, FRC clothing, other required PPE, etc.
- Calculate tank truck loads and record the quantity to load on the paperwork.
- Check all paperwork and pertinent information regarding the quantity and unload instructions for tank truck unloads.
- For all trucks not processed through automation, including the final bill of lading, the correct safety data sheet, scale ticket, etc.
- Separate paperwork and distribute accordingly.
- Enter all scale tickets into the computer.
- Maintain all required supplies (i.e. seals, scale tickets, etc.)
- Acts as central communications center during off-hours and for emergencies.
- During emergencies, call personnel and handle other instructions, as directed by the Safety Department.
- Assist the Land Traffic Department, as directed by the Land Traffic Supervisor.
- Prepare and issue Scale Relief Log.
- Marine Dispatch/Scalehouse shift relief as needed.
Skills & Qualifications
- High school diploma or equivalent.
- Minimum of three years experience within the terminal or petrochemical industry handling hazardous and non hazardous products.
- Experience with J.D. Edwards or other ERP systems, all Microsoft Office software, use of the Internet, and ten-key calculator.
- Good analytical and problem solving skills.
- Good decision making and communication skills.
